The Anchor, Volume 118.07: October 13, 2004, Hope College Oct 2004

The Anchor, Volume 118.07: October 13, 2004, Hope College

The Anchor: 2004

The Anchor began in 1887 and was first issued weekly in 1914. Covering national and campus news alike, Hope College’s student-run newspaper has grown over the years to encompass over two-dozen editors, reporters, and staff. For much of The Anchor's history, the latest issue was distributed across campus each Wednesday throughout the academic school year (with few exceptions). As of Fall 2019 The Anchor has moved to monthly print issues and a more frequently updated website. Occasionally, the volume and/or issue numbering is irregular.

2004 Hog Prices - The “Perfect Storm”?, Al Prosch Oct 2004

2004 Hog Prices - The “Perfect Storm”?, Al Prosch

Cornhusker Economics

In 2004 we’ve had the highest hog prices since 1997 (Figure 1). At the same time, we have had record hog slaughter. Perhaps the most telling comment for this year was made by Glen Grimes at the National Pork Board Educators Seminar in September. Glen stated that in all his years he has never seen anything like this. Supply has been up and price has been up more.

Effects Of Disability Disclosure And Acknowledgment On Ratings Of Interviewees With Visible Disabilities, Lisa Lynn Roberts Oct 2004

Effects Of Disability Disclosure And Acknowledgment On Ratings Of Interviewees With Visible Disabilities, Lisa Lynn Roberts

Dissertations

While some authors stress the benefits of disclosing one's disability prior to the interview in order to eliminate interviewer surprise, attention-related research suggests that such disclosure is likely to result in self-focused thinking by the interviewer, reducing the ability to judge performance accurately. Similarly, verbal acknowledgment of a visible disability during an interview has been predicted to reduce interviewer anxiety, yet some authors contend that acknowledgment is a violation of the rules of interviewing and adds to discomfort. The present research addressed the question: What are the effects of an applicant's pre-interview disability disclosure and disability acknowledgment during the interview? …
